Are there benefits to drinking Apple cider vinegar with Mother?

Mother in apple cider vinegar refers to the strand-like enzymes of proteins and friendly bacteria that are naturally produced during the fermentation process of apple cider vinegar. These enzymes and bacteria create a murky, cobweb-like substance that settles at the bottom of the vinegar bottle or container. The presence of the "mother" is considered a sign of high-quality, unfiltered apple cider vinegar and is believed to provide additional health benefits beyond those of regular vinegar. The "mother" is thought to contain beneficial probiotics and enzymes that can support digestion, boost the immune system, and improve overall health.

Apple cider vinegar with the "Mother" refers to the presence of the murky, web-like strands that are visible in unfiltered apple cider vinegar. These strands are composed of beneficial bacteria and enzymes and are believed to be responsible for many of the potential health benefits of apple cider vinegar.

Here are some of the potential benefits of drinking apple cider vinegar with "Mother":
  • Improved digestion: The probiotics and enzymes in apple cider vinegar with "Mother" may help to improve digestion and reduce symptoms of indigestion, such as bloating and gas.
  • Lowered blood sugar: Some studies suggest that apple cider vinegar may help to improve insulin sensitivity and lower blood sugar levels, particularly after meals.
  • Weight loss: Apple cider vinegar may help promote weight loss by increasing feelings of fullness and reducing calorie intake.
  • Lowered cholesterol and blood pressure: Some studies have found that apple cider vinegar may help to lower cholesterol levels and blood pressure, which are both risk factors for heart disease.
  • Improved skin health: Apple cider vinegar may help to improve skin health by reducing inflammation and preventing acne.
  • Reduced risk of chronic disease: Some studies have found that apple cider vinegar may help reduce the risk of chronic diseases such as cancer and Alzheimer's disease, although more research is needed to confirm these benefits.

It's important to note that the benefits of apple cider vinegar with "mother" may vary depending on the individual, and more research is needed to confirm its potential health benefits. It's also important to dilute apple cider vinegar before consuming it, as undiluted vinegar can be harmful to tooth enamel and the esophagus.
